Understanding Remittix’s Strategy

Remittix is not merely another cryptocurrency vying for a share of the remittance pie; it is leveraging a unique approach that differentiates it from XRP. While Ripple focuses on established banking and financial systems, Remittix aims to capture the attention of unbanked populations and small businesses through lower fees and faster transaction times. This focus on accessibility could resonate well in regions where traditional banking services are limited, presenting a formidable challenge to XRP.
